The ‘King of beers’ Budweiser comes to Jamaica
By: Trudy Williams

The ‘King of Beers’ Budweiser, and Bud Light is now available in Jamaica. Anheuser-Busch announced recently that Budweiser and Bud Light will be distributed in Jamaica by the Wisynco Group Limited. It is currently available for purchase in select restaurants, supermarkets and bars across the island.
Anheuser-Busch made the decision to expand their distribution of Budweiser to Jamaica at this time, as it represents an interesting market that has an appreciation for a good beer and whose consumers are sure to be pleased by its clean, crisp and refreshing taste.
Anheuser Busch believes strongly that Budweiser has distinct advantages over the other leading brands including: Quality – all-natural ingredients, crisp, clean taste; Brand name – an internationally recognized name; image – as a young, fun, cool brand that is associated with sports; partnership with Wisynco – experienced and well-entrenched in the market.
William Mahfood, Managing Director of Wisynco welcomes its status as exclusive distributor of Budweiser and Bud Light. The company has a well established distribution network which will be used to distribute the beers throughout the island. Mr. Mahfood said “Wisynco successfully distributes many world class brands in Jamaica and I believe that our experience with Budweiser and Bud Light will be no different.”
According to Mr. Mahfood, “we are a food and beverage company that sees an opportunity to expand into the alcoholic beverage market and specifically the beer segment that has proven to be profitable here in Jamaica. Budweiser and Bud Light are two international iconic brands with superior drinkability and we feel strongly that they will do well in Jamaican market.”
Budweiser is an American lager which has been brewed since 1876 using a blend of U.S. and European hops, and a combination of barley malts and rice. A centuries-old, European-aging technique called kraeusening is also used, which involves adding a small amount of freshly yeasted wort to fermenting beer at the start of the aging cycle to facilitate natural carbonation. Then, Anheuser-Busch’s exclusive beechwood aging process helps create a crisp, clean taste. It contains 5% alcohol by volume (per 355 ml. serving) and will be distributed in bottles and cans.
Anheuser Busch which is based in St. Louis, is the leading American brewer and it controls 50.9% share of U.S. beer sales. The company brews the world’s largest-selling beers, Budweiser and Bud Light. Anheuser-Busch is ranked No. 1 among beverage companies in FORTUNE Magazine’s Most Admired U.S. and Global Companies lists in 2008.
